In Europe: Travels Through the Twentieth Century by Geert Mak
3.0
I can only echo the many superlatives that are expressed in the reviews: it's a great overview of the 20th century in Europe, handsomely told through travelogues. I noticed a few historical errors and dated views, but I certainly do not want to undervalue the merit of this book. In my opinion the strongest chapter was on the second world war. In the chapters starting with the 1950's the tempo was a bit too high and the stories Geert Mak relates inevitably became more personal and subjective.
